A panoramic view of the evolution of life on our planet, from its origins to humanity's future.A panoramic view of the evolution of life on our planet, from its origins to humanity's future.In A History of Bodies, Brains, and Minds, Francisco Aboitiz provides a brief history of life, the brain, and cognition, from the earliest living beings to our own species. The author proceeds from the basic premise that, since evolution by natural selection is the process underlying the origin of life and its evolution on earth, the brain-and thus our minds-must also be the result of biological evolution. The aim of this book is to narrate how animal bodies came to be built with their nervous systems and how our species evolved with culture, technology, language, and consciousness.The book is organized in four parts, each delving into a different aspect of evolutionary development-. Definitions lays the groundwork by discussing the principles of biological evolution and explores the definition and mechanisms of life itself. Beginnings describes the origins of life, starting from the emergence of the first cells to the development of neurons as the building blocks for brain networks. The Rise of Bodies and Brains examines the evolution of animals with bilateral symmetry, the emergence of chordates and vertebrates, and the expansion and diversification of the vertebrate brain. A Singular Ape explores Homo sapiens and our species' unique traits, such as bipedality, tool use, culture, language, communication, and consciousness.Comprehensive and deeply insightful, this book helps us understand our place in the natural world and the cosmos-as well as what the future might hold for life on earth. But in addition to asking what attention actually is, decomposing and analyzing its varieties, or delimiting its neurobiological mechanisms and effects, in this volume we want to explore attention somewhat differently. We believe that a full-fledged theory of attention must consider its workings in the context of motivated, goal-directed, and environmentally constrained organisms. That attention is related to goal-directed behavior is not news. What the contri- tions to this volume do suggest, however, is the existence of fundamental links between attention and two key processes that are crucial for adapted conduct: go- directed behavior and cognitive control. Importantly, they show that these relations can be explored at multiple levels, including neurodynamical, neurochemical, evo- tionary, and clinical aspects, and that in doing so multiple methodological challenges arise that are worth considering and pursuing. The reader will find here, therefore, a selection of contributions that range from basic mechanisms of attention at the n- ronal level to developmental aspects of cognitive control and its impairments.
